What is CVE-2018-5779?
A serious security flaw exists within the conferencing component of Mitel Connect ONSITE and Mitel ST, which could allow an unauthenticated attacker to inject malicious scripts into newly created PHP files. By crafting specific requests, the attacker could execute arbitrary code, compromising the integrity of the application. This vulnerability emphasizes the need for strict access controls and regular security updates to protect against unauthorized scripting activities.
